What’s a Filler Rod Anyway?

Imagine you’re trying to connect two Lego pieces that don’t quite fit together. Frustrating, right? You need something to fill that gap. That’s where the filler rod comes in—like the perfect Lego piece to make everything fit. So, in welding terms, a filler rod adds extra material to the joint being welded. This ensures a complete and strong bond between the two pieces of metal. Think of it as the unsung hero of the welding world.

Why Do We Need Them?

Okay, so why is that extra material so crucial? Well, when two metal parts don’t touch exactly or have small gaps between them, the filler rod swoops in to save the day. Not only does it fill those annoying gaps, but it also enhances the weld’s strength and integrity. This means that after you’re done welding, your creation isn’t just pretty; it’s strong and durable!

Filler Rods in Action: MIG and TIG Welding

If you’re diving into the world of welding, you’ll probably encounter two major players: MIG (Metal Inert Gas) and TIG (Tungsten Inert Gas) welding. Both processes utilize filler rods but in slightly different ways.

  • MIG Welding: This method feeds a continuous filler rod as you work, making it super handy for larger jobs. The machine does most of the heavy lifting, feeding the wire into the welding arc continuously. It’s fast-paced!
  • TIG Welding: Here, you’re in more of a hands-on role. The filler rod is introduced manually as you weld, giving you control over how much material is added. It requires a delicate touch, but man, the results can be stunning!
